Hawking radiation, a theoretical phenomenon where black holes emit radiation and evaporate, has never been observed due to the extremely slow evaporation rate of stellar-mass black holes, the faintness of the emitted radiation, and the ongoing accretion of matter by most black holes.
Hawking radiation is a theoretical prediction that black holes emit radiation and eventually evaporate.
The evaporation process is incredibly slow for stellar-mass black holes, taking far longer than the age of the universe.
The radiation emitted is extraordinarily faint and difficult to detect with current technology.
Accretion of matter by black holes counteracts mass loss from Hawking radiation.
